WebMay 23, 2024 · Bicarbonate is alkaline, a base, and neutralizes the acid secreted by the parietal cells, producing water in the process. This continuous supply of bicarbonate is the main way that the stomach protects itself from the stomach digesting itself and the overall acidic environment.
